Abstract

Abstrak. Kegiatan Asesmen (Assessment) merupakan bagian penting dalam proses pembelajaran yang bertujuan untuk menggali informasi terkait dengan hasil belajar dan proses pembelajaran yang telah dilakukan untuk selanjutnya dijadikan patokan untuk mengevaluasi peserta didik dan proses pembelajaran. Proses asesmen yang dilakukan dengan baik dan objektif akan menghasikan penilaian yang baik dan juga objektif pula  serta mampu mengukur apa saja yang perlu untuk diukur sehigga perbaikan proses pembelajaran dapat dilakukan secara optimal. Pandemi yang melanda indonesia setahun terakhir berdampak pada pelaksanaan pembelajaran yang harus dilakukan secara online, begitupun dengan proses asesmen hasil belajar peserta didik. Namun kenyataan dilapangan, masih banyak guru yang belum menguasai asesmen berbasis digital. Kegiatan Pelatihan asesmen digital dengan Google Form bagi guru sekolah menengah di Kabupaten Gowa dilakukan untuk meningkatkan pengetahuan dan keterampilan guru dalam membuat asesmen digital sebagai media evaluasi hasil belajar peserta didik. Pelatihan dilakukan selama satu hari pelatihan secara luring, dan dilanjutkan tiga hari pendampingan secara daring melalui aplikasi telegram. Adapun hasil yang dicapai setelah dilaksanakannya kegiatan pelatihan ini adalah peningkatan pengetahuan kemampuan guru dalam membuat asesmen digital dengan Google Form, dan respon yang diberikan oleh peserta pelatihan terhadap pelaksanaan kegiatan ini berada pada kategori sangat baik dengan skor 3,78.   Kata Kunci:Pelatihan, Asesmen digital, Hasil Belajar, Google Form,

Abstract

This study investigates the effect of the Socio-Scientific Issue (SSI) learning approach on problem-solving skills, science literacy, and biology learning outcomes of Class XI students at SMAN 1 Gowa. The decline in students' problem-solving skills and science literacy, evidenced by Indonesia's consistently low scores in international assessments such as PISA, calls for innovative instructional approaches. This quasi-experimental study employed a Non-Equivalent Control Group Design with 72 students divided into an experimental class (SSI approach) and a control class (Scientific Approach/5M). Data were collected using essay tests, multiple-choice tests, and structured observation. Analysis included descriptive and inferential statistics using IBM SPSS version 26. Results showed that the SSI class achieved a higher posttest mean in problem-solving skills (81.03 vs. 79.67), science literacy (83.69 vs. 79.22), and cognitive learning outcomes (87.78 vs. 80.14) compared to the control class. Independent Samples T-Test confirmed significant differences for all three variables (p = 0.000 < 0.05). The SSI approach proved more effective than the Scientific Approach in simultaneously developing students’ 21st-century competencies, particularly through contextual engagement with socio-scientific issues related to the human reproductive system.

Abstract

Diabetes mellitus is known as a chronic metabolic disease characterized by impaired insulin production or function, resulting in prolonged hyperglycemia. The availability of safe, effective, and affordable insulin is crucial in managing this disease. Advances in biotechnology through the application of recombinant DNA technology (RDT) have enabled the mass production of human insulin with high purity. This literature review aims to analyze the application of recombinant DNA technology in insulin production and evaluate its contribution as a diabetes mellitus therapy. The method used was a Systematic Literature Review (SLR) of various scientific articles and relevant academic sources discussing genetic engineering processes, microorganism expression systems, and the effectiveness of recombinant insulin through the Scopus database. The results of the study indicate that the technique of inserting the human insulin gene into a plasmid vector and expressing it through microorganisms such as Escherichia coli or yeast allows the production of insulin that is structurally identical to natural human insulin. This technology improves therapeutic safety, reduces the risk of immunological reactions compared to animal-based insulin, and supports the availability of industrial-scale production. The application of recombinant DNA technology plays a significant role in the development of more effective, safe, and sustainable diabetes mellitus therapies.
